johnzon-core/src/main/java/org/apache/johnzon/core/JsonGeneratorImpl.java (4 lines): - line 105: //FIXME if buffer is flushed this will not work here - line 167: //TODO check null handling - line 191: //TODO optimize - line 215: //TODO check null handling johnzon-jsonb/src/main/java/org/apache/johnzon/jsonb/JsonbAccessMode.java (4 lines): - line 531: } else if (dateFormat != null) { // TODO: support lists, LocalDate? - line 545: } else if (numberFormat != null) { // TODO: support lists? - line 844: public Adapter findAdapter(final Class clazz) { // TODO: find a way to not parse twice - line 943: // TODO: spec requirement, this sounds wrong since you cant customize 2 kind of serializations on the same model johnzon-mapper/src/main/java/org/apache/johnzon/mapper/access/BaseAccessMode.java (3 lines): - line 100: return null; // TODO: converter? - line 105: return null; // TODO: converter? - line 110: return null; // TODO: converter? johnzon-core/src/main/java/org/apache/johnzon/core/JsonPatchImpl.java (2 lines): - line 63: //X TODO JsonPointer should use generics like JsonPatch - line 98: //X TODO dirty cast can be removed after JsonPointer uses generics like JsonPatch johnzon-jsonb/src/main/java/org/apache/johnzon/jsonb/JohnzonBuilder.java (2 lines): - line 319: // TODO: support PT in ObjectConverter (list) - line 337: // TODO: support PT in ObjectConverter (list) johnzon-jsonb/src/main/java/org/apache/johnzon/jsonb/serializer/JohnzonSerializationContext.java (1 line): - line 26: // TODO: fix it johnzon-mapper/src/main/java/org/apache/johnzon/mapper/Mappings.java (1 line): - line 700: } // TODO: map johnzon-jsonb/src/main/java/org/apache/johnzon/jsonb/converter/JsonbDateConverter.java (1 line): - line 35: // TODO: cheap impl to avoid to rely on exceptions, better can be to parse format johnzon-jsonschema/src/main/java/org/apache/johnzon/jsonschema/JsonSchemaValidatorFactory.java (1 line): - line 118: // TODO: dependencies, propertyNames, if/then/else, allOf/anyOf/oneOf/not, johnzon-mapper/src/main/java/org/apache/johnzon/mapper/reflection/Converters.java (1 line): - line 36: // TODO: more ParameterizedType and maybe TypeClosure support johnzon-mapper/src/main/java/org/apache/johnzon/mapper/MappingParserImpl.java (1 line): - line 1103: mapping.clazz, //X TODO ObjectConverter in @JohnzonConverter with Constructors! johnzon-maven-plugin/src/main/java/org/apache/johnzon/maven/plugin/ExampleToModelMojo.java (1 line): - line 104: // TODO: unicity of field name, better nested array/object handling johnzon-mapper/src/main/java/org/apache/johnzon/mapper/number/Validator.java (1 line): - line 29: // TODO: ATTENTION: this is only an intermediate solution until JOHNZON-177